The Labyrinth of Shadows: A Demon's Redemption

In the heart of a forsaken forest, shrouded in perpetual twilight, lay the entrance to the Labyrinth of Shadows. This labyrinth was not merely a physical structure but a realm of the mind, a place where the boundaries between the living and the damned blurred into an ethereal mist. Here, the demon known as Aria was bound, her form a living cipher, her soul a prisoner to the curse that had been cast upon her by the High Council of the Damned.

Aria's tale was as old as the labyrinth itself. Once a mortal woman, she had been cursed by the council for her forbidden love with a human. The curse had transformed her into a demon, stripping her of her humanity and her memory, leaving her to wander the labyrinth in search of her past and her redemption.

The Labyrinth of Shadows was a place of twisted paths and shifting illusions. Some believed it was a test of one's resolve, while others whispered that it was a trap, designed to ensnare the unwary and keep them forever within its walls. Aria had spent centuries navigating its treacherous corridors, her mind a battleground between her desire for freedom and the fear of the power she had been denied.

One day, as the sun dipped below the horizon, casting a crimson glow upon the labyrinth's entrance, Aria felt a shift within her. The curse seemed to weaken, the chains that bound her soul loosening. She knew this was her chance. With a heart pounding and a mind brimming with uncertainty, she stepped into the labyrinth once more.

The labyrinth was alive, its walls whispering secrets of Aria's past. She passed through rooms where her memories played out like a haunting film, each scene a reminder of the life she had lost and the love she had forsaken. She encountered her own reflection, now twisted and monstrous, a constant reminder of the curse that had consumed her.

In one of the labyrinth's more perilous chambers, Aria faced her greatest challenge. The chamber was filled with mirrors, each one reflecting her twisted form, her past, and her future. She was caught in a loop of reflections, unable to move forward or backward. It was here that she discovered the truth about her curse: it was not just a physical transformation but a mental one as well.

With newfound clarity, Aria realized that her redemption lay not in escaping the labyrinth but in accepting her true nature and learning to harness the power within her. She began to embrace the shadows, using them as a shield against the mirrors' illusions. She discovered that her power was not to be feared but to be understood and controlled.

As Aria continued her journey, she encountered other souls trapped within the labyrinth, each one bound by their own curses. Among them was a young man named Eamon, a human who had been cursed for his compassion. He had become a ghost, invisible to the living and bound to the labyrinth by his own guilt.

Aria and Eamon became unlikely allies, each bringing their own strengths to the table. Aria's power to navigate the labyrinth and Eamon's knowledge of the human world. Together, they faced the labyrinth's greatest challenge: the Council of Shadows, the beings who had cursed them both.

The Council was a group of ancient demons, their forms twisted and dark, their eyes filled with malice. They challenged Aria and Eamon to a duel, knowing that the outcome would determine their fates. Aria and Eamon fought with all their might, their battle echoing through the labyrinth's corridors.

In the end, it was Aria's acceptance of her power that won the day. She used her newfound understanding to break the curse, not just for herself but for Eamon as well. With a final, resounding crack, the curse was shattered, and Aria and Eamon were freed from the labyrinth.

As the two emerged from the labyrinth, the sun rose, casting a golden light upon the forsaken forest. Aria and Eamon, once cursed, now free, stood together, their fates intertwined. They had faced their shadows and emerged not as monsters, but as beings of light and shadow, bound by the strength of their shared journey.

The Labyrinth of Shadows had been a test, and they had passed. Aria had found her redemption, and Eamon had found peace. Together, they walked into the light, their pasts behind them, their futures ahead.
